
Rhododendron ‘Cherries and Merlot’
Rhododendron - Cherries and Merlot
An outstanding, elepidote, medium growing Rhododendron. 2″ wavy, vivid red flowers are born in trusses of 18 flowers, early midseason. Its pièce de résistance, the stunning rich red colour seen on the undersides of its leaves! Grows 3′-4′ high and wide in a 10 year period.

Origin
Hybrid seedling of a Rhododendron ('Pretty Baby x pachysanthum) hybrid and Rhododendron 'Whid Bee'. Bred by Frank Fujioka of Washington in 2001.
Special Notes
Exposure: Morning Sun, afternoon shade or all day filtered light. Protect from the hot mid-day sun. Protect from the prevailing winter winds, plant in a sheltered location.
Soil: A very acidic, moist but well draining soil is required. Avoid heavy compacted soils such as clay.
Maintenance: Selective pruning right after flowering in done. Dead-heading is recommended for increased flower production the following year.
